Handover note — Consent banner rollout (Pellamy → Orskin)

The Foxbriar consent banner is now live in all regions except Velmont, which goes out Thursday. Support should know that banner text is served from the Lanternfall config service, so copy changes do not require a deploy. Dismissal state is stored client-side for ninety days; users reporting a reappearing banner have usually cleared storage. If the banner fails to render at all, check the Lanternfall health page first. The current rollout configuration values are listed below.

deployment values, tafog-kagap:
wenath:
  pin: 4244
  metrics_host: metrics.wenath.lumicsys.internal
  tenant: istix
  seal: seal_10585894

Re: Chalkline timetable solver. Blocking until weights are externalized. Hardcoding penalty coefficients inside the annealer makes every term-start tuning a full release. Move them to config, keep the same names. Also: room-clash penalty must stay strictly larger than teacher-gap penalty or the solver trades clashes for prettier schedules — saw this at the Dennerby pilot. Add a startup assertion for that ordering. Otherwise fine; convergence numbers look good. The current coefficients are as follows.

constants for kageg-bawif:
QUOTAS = {
    "quenwyn": 1,
    "oliix": 10,
}

Handover — FY Headcount. Board: plan assumes 14 net adds, weighted to Velmark engineering and the Osteray sales pod. Freeze holds elsewhere until Q2 revenue confirms. Attrition modeled at 9%. Rilla Fenwick owns execution from Monday; I remain available through month-end. The confidential note on related business plans appears directly below.

confidential, bahap-bajog: Zorethix Works is in early talks to buy Kelethox Foods for about $30.7 million. The Ralvan launch date is September 19, and nothing goes to the press before then.